In the ever-evolving landscape of media consumption, the lines between genuine content and paid promotion are becoming increasingly blurred. This phenomenon gives rise to advertorials, a unique form of advertising that seamlessly integrates promotional content into editorial content. Masterfully crafted advertorials endeavor to inform and engage audiences while gently promoting a product, service, or company. The line between truth and persuasion remain at the forefront of this evolving sphere, as consumers become increasingly aware of these subtle advertising strategies.

Walking the Line: Navigating Transparency in Advertorials

Advertorials, the blurred line between marketing and editorial content, present a unique challenge for publishers striving to maintain trust with their audiences. While advertorials can be a valuable revenue stream, concealing the lines of honesty can erode reader confidence. here To successfully navigate this ethical tightrope, publishers must prioritize clear identification of advertorial content and adhere to strict standards that ensure authenticity and honesty.
